Item Number:415-129-SHC-TP3
Document Title:MIDDLESEX; SKETCH FOR NEW ENTRANCE TO OVAL
Project:00415; Middlesex School; Winsor School (crossed out PI) -- -- --; Concord; Massachusetts; 04 College & School Campuses; 309 PLANS (1900-1930)
Artist/Creator:ZACH,
Location:Olmsted National Historic Site, Brookline, MA
Category:PLAN
Purpose:ST (Study)
Physical Characteristics:FAIR H 17 1/2, W 30" graphite --color p/c trace
Dates:28FEB1924
Notes:SKETCH OF AREA INCLUDING PLANTING; THERE APPEARS TO BE THREE GENERATIONS OF ALTERNATIVE SKETCHES; DUPLICATE LETTER SHEET, FROM GENERATIONS GIVEN TP#'S; UNNUMBERED SHEETS ASSIGNED ARBITRARY SHEET LETTERS
Please credit: Courtesy of the United States Department of the Interior, National Park Service, Frederick Law Olmsted National Historic Site.
